About the Airtac SC80 Standard Cylinder SC80X900S

The SC80X900S is an 80 mm bore, 900 mm stroke double-acting pneumatic cylinder from the AirTAC SC tie-rod series. It generates a substantial push force of 2513 N at 0.5 MPa and can reach 4523 N at the maximum operating pressure of 0.9 MPa, making it well-suited for demanding linear motion tasks. The built-in magnet allows direct mounting of CMSG, DMSG, or EMSG sensors on the barrel for reliable, non-contact position sensing.

With a 25 mm diameter piston rod and an M20x1.5 rod thread, this cylinder provides robust mechanical connection for tooling. The PT3/8 port supplies ample air flow for speeds up to 800 mm/s, while the 28 mm adjustable air cushion at each end decelerates the piston smoothly to reduce end-of-stroke impact. The total extended body length is approximately 1082 mm (182 mm body length A + 900 mm stroke).

Is the Airtac SC80 Standard Cylinder SC80X900S the Right Cylinder?

Select the SC80X900S when your application requires a force output in the 2500 N range at standard factory pressure. If your load demands exceed 3500 N at 0.5 MPa, consider stepping up to the 100 mm bore model (3927 N push at 0.5 MPa). For a lighter, more compact solution, the 63 mm bore provides 1559 N at 0.5 MPa.

At 900 mm stroke, the piston rod is extended significantly. Always evaluate side-load conditions; an unsupported rod at full extension is vulnerable to bending and seal wear. For applications with off-centre loads, use an external linear guide or a guided cylinder to protect the rod and bearing. For a drop-in replacement, match the 80 mm bore, 900 mm stroke, PT3/8 port, built-in magnet (-S), and basic mounting configuration.

Installation & Maintenance Notes

  • check Use clean air filtered to 40µm or finer.
  • check Keep within 0.15 – 1.0 MPa operating pressure.
  • check Avoid side load on the piston rod.
  • check Adjust end cushion screws for smooth stops.
  • check Use correct mounting accessory (FA/FB/CA/CB/LB/TC).
  • check Installation by qualified personnel per AirTAC docs.
